コード例 #1
0
 public async void Loaded()
 {
     foreach (var knownFolder in ShellKnownFolders.EnumerateKnownFolders())
     {
         this.KnownFolders.Add(await ShellKnownFolderViewModel.CreateAsync(knownFolder));
     }
 }
コード例 #2
0
        public static Task <ShellKnownFolderViewModel> CreateAsync(ShellKnownFolder shellKnownFolder)
        {
            return(Task.Run(() =>
            {
                var result = new ShellKnownFolderViewModel(shellKnownFolder);
                result.Thumbnail.Value = new ShellImageSource(shellKnownFolder.GetThumbnail(ThumbnailMode.ListView));

                return result;
            }));
        }